This thesis focuses on the development of a framework for automated testing of student-submitted code in the Distributed Systems course. The goal is to accelerate and improve the accuracy of grading. The developed solution includes unit tests for the Go programming language. Various tools such as Git and GitHub are used for version control, along with the VS Code development environment. The results benefit both students and course instructors as reference points for faster code testing and assignment evaluation.
|